Hvac Gas Furnace Installation in Kansas City, MO

HVAC gas furnace installation involves setting up a new gas-powered heating system to keep a property warm during colder months. This service covers a range of projects, including replacing outdated or inefficient furnaces, upgrading to higher-capacity units for larger spaces, or installing a furnace in a new construction. Property owners typically want to understand the compatibility of the furnace with their existing ductwork, the energy efficiency of different models, and the overall process involved in the installation to ensure a smooth and effective heating solution.

Before requesting gas furnace installation, homeowners should consider factors such as the size of the space needing heating, fuel supply availability,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ply. It's also helpful to understand the types of furnaces available, their maintenance requirements, and how the new system will integrate with existing heating components. Clear communication about project scope and expectations can help ensure the installation meets the property's heating needs effectively.

Hvac Gas Furnace Installation Questions

What is involved in installing a gas furnace? The process includes removing the old unit, preparing the installation area, and connecting the new furnace to the gas and electrical systems.

How do I know if my property needs a new gas furnace? Signs include frequent breakdowns, inefficient heating, or an aging unit that no longer meets heating demands.

Are there different types of gas furnaces available? Yes, options include single-stage, two-stage, and modulating furnaces, each offering different efficiency levels and performance features.

What should property owners consider before installing a gas furnace? It’s important to evaluate the size of the property, existing ductwork, and compatibility with the new furnace to ensure optimal performance.
